Post subject:  hooking the 555 up to turntables/mixer

Me and a friend are trying to hook the 555 up to his mixer and turntables, I want it so that the effects can be applied to the rocords on the turntables, is that possible?

Thanks

Author:  hurlingdervish [ Mon Aug 10, 2009 9:19 pm ]
Post subject:  Re: hooking the 555 up to turntables/mixer

more than possible its one of the main reasons it exists :mrgreen:

either have the mixer going out to the 555 or if the mixer has a send have it running to the 555 and back

lol RTFM

press effect assign + line in

you have assign effects to line in
